Biological Background: IKZF3 Function and Localization

  • IKZF3 (Aiolos) is a zinc finger transcription factor belonging to the Ikaros family, which plays a critical role in lymphocyte development and differentiation.
  • It regulates B-cell differentiation, proliferation, and maturation into effector states, and modulates apoptosis in T-cells by controlling BCL2 expression in an IL-2-dependent manner.
  • The protein localizes to both the nucleus and cytoplasm, consistent with its transcriptional regulatory functions and potential shuttling mechanisms.
  • IKZF3 is highly expressed in peripheral blood leukocytes, spleen, and thymus, reflecting its importance in immune cell biology.
  • As a member of the Ikaros family, it contains zinc finger domains that mediate DNA binding and protein-protein interactions.
  • Post-translational modifications such as phosphorylation and isopeptide bond formation (ubiquitination) regulate its activity, and alternative splicing generates multiple isoforms.
  • Mutations in IKZF3 are associated with disease variants, underscoring its significance in immune disorders.

Experimental Guidance and Technical Tips

  • The antibody was raised against a peptide spanning residues 1-100 of human IKZF3; consider using this region as a positive control in peptide competition assays.
  • For western blotting, the predicted protein weight is approximately 58 kDa; validate band specificity in relevant human or rat lysates (e.g., peripheral blood leukocytes).
  • In immunofluorescence and immunohistochemistry, nuclear and/or cytoplasmic staining may be observed depending on cell type and activation state.
  • When applying to ELISA, confirm coating conditions and antibody pair compatibility in your assay system.
